My experience with Lesco Appliances LLC is detailed in the complaint that I filed with the Better Business Bureau.



Complaint # 1451814. Filed on : June 13 2012. Filed against :

Lesco Appliances LLC

1901 State St

Granite City IL 62040



On May 29, 2012 Home Warranty of America sent Lesco Appliance LLC to my home to repair my central AC system. The unit is covered by Home Warranty of America. Lesco inspected the system and stated that the AC unit outside could not be repaired and needed to be replaced (the new unit was covered by the Home Warranty of America). Lesco stated there was $1,542.29 in items/modifications that were not covered by the warranty. We gave Lesco my credit card to pay for the $100 deductible service call fee required by Home Warranty of America. We said we will consider their quotation. Home Warranty sent a second company to examine my AC unit and provide a second quote and second opinion. The second company said the outdoor unit did not need to be replaced. The system needed a coil replaced (which had a leak) and a freon recharge. The repair of the unit involved only $50 in non warranty charges. The second company said a new outdoor AC unit was not needed and that the non warranty charges quoted by Lesco were highly inflated. For instance, the second company said that a line item of $650 for duct modification should cost no more than $150. The second company repaired the AC unit with authorization from myself and Home Warranty of America. On June 7th, I discovered Lesco had charged my credit card $1542.29. Lesco charged my credit card $1542.29. Neither I or Home Warranty of America authorized Lesco to proceed with the repair. Home Warranty of America needed to authorize the covered charges and I needed to authorize the non-covered charges. I phoned Lesco and requested a refund on June 7th. The Lesco representative said the charge was a mistake and they would correct it. The representative also said he would phone back later in the day to confirm it was fixed. I did not hear back from Lesco that day. I subsequently left two messages (on separate days) with Lesco inquiring on the status of the refund. Lesco did not respond to those messages and are no longer returning my calls. My credit card company indicates the no credit has been issued to my credit card from Lesco as of June 13th. Hence, I am filing this complaint with the BBB.

Called Home Warranty Company on April 3 2012 they told me he would call withing 48 hours after I called several time he finally showed up April 11th 2012 took my co pay and said it was a defrost heater and we have not heard from him since and neither has the Home Warranty Company. Now Im jumping thru hoops trying to get my copay back as the Home Warranty Company advised me they will no longer work with him and they have no one in my area to help me. I live 15 minutes from St. louis. It is now May 4th and I still have no refrigerator

Techincian name 'Bill' came in to see my not working right 3 door reach in refrigerator. He told me that compressor need to replaced and gave me estimation of $2000. I asked how much brand new cost. He answered brand new True 3door reach in will cost $15000. This company do not sell new appliances. What they trying here is get a business by telling me wrong info. I am not native english speaker and look pretty young. He probably thought I do not know about those appliances. And they will charge u $140/ hour on labor. Not too honest ppl.

I can safely say I will never use this company again. I wish I had researched them more before calling for a repair. They came out, charged me $139 for a part I have seen online for about $50. Tried to charge me a service charge even though their website says "Free service call with repair". Told me they don't take credit cards even though their website says, "Checks & all major credit cards accepted." I still feel like I was overcharged for the repair. Do your research on this company before you call them. Your findings will be enlightening.
